To start you
want to conquer the fear of buying something you are not
going to see first. To do so, figure out what you will be
doing with the tires from a tire special. Are you an
off-roader or a city driver? Choosing the right tire is
very, very important. Consult the owner's manual in your
vehicle for the exact measurements and speed rating that
your tires need to be. Speed ratings will start at S, the
lowest grade, and the go up through T, U, H, V, W, Y, Z; Z
is then
your highest rating. The higher grade will mean that the tires
from the tire specials are safer to
drive.
It is also
very important to educate yourself on the different parts of
the tire. This way you will
assure yourself the best possible tire for the best possible
situations. Some of the major ones
you should look at are the treads, sidewalls, cap, body plies,
and the DOT stamp that assures
your tires meets Department of Transportation
standards.
